Remarks

Good- experienced and very professional faculty. Staff members are very helpful here. Very good environment for studies. Campus area is very neat and clean and very beautiful plants and a lot of tress add up to the environment. Students are very friendly and well mannered so there is no chance of ragging or miss behaving. Canteen to sports everything is good Bad- new sports equipment takes a lot of time to come. One have to wait for the merit based cutoff which is released by du to get admission into this college then select the course you want to get admission for.fill the necessary details on the site and then one have to wait for 1-2 days for your admission approval. The most important reason to prefer this college was it was the best college for the course I want to opt under the marks I scored in my 12th boards. And I also checked the reviews it was quite nice.

Course Curriculum Overview

3.5

I opted this course because the things it includes are mostly matching with the things I love to do and a future into which I love to do ,which is exploring earth and discovering new things (stones, minlerals etc) is like a dream If we talk about faculty student ratio there is 1 teacher per 6 students so one in a need will always find a teacher near by to get help There are well qualified teachers and are always willing to help, thus making the teaching quality good. The methodology of teaching adopted here include presentations and verbal communication which is quite understandableVarious practical as well as theoretical concepts are taught which makes it easier to understand. Students get full support by teachers in this college The course curriculum is very relevant and it helps to gain practical knowledge which is relevant for the commerce industry. Class test is taken on regular basis to check the understandings half yearly exams are also conducted which is not very difficult.

Placement Experience

2.5

From 4th to 5th semester student becomes eligible for campus placement. The highest salary package offered to students of our college was 8 LPA, while the lowest salary package offered was 3 LPA. Academically average students can get a salary package ranging from 3 LPA to 5 LPA. Our college has good tie-ups with companies like Google, Amazon, Reliance, IBS, Infosys and many more private companies. There is a placement cell which takes care of all placement activities and is growing year by year and creating new records in placements. About 50% of the students get placed with an average salary package every year. The placement rate is not pretty good because companies found a very less number of skilled students I will opt for higher studies so that I can get most knowledge of my subject. Companies will obviously like to recruit an employee with a lot of knowledge of work.

Fees and Financial Aid

The duration of the course is 3 years for which one have to pay approx INR 45000 Yearly one have to pay INR 21000 and approx 2000 for every semester exams Various field trips are also couducted which is also very important to attend for this one have to pay for each and everything by self No scholarship or financial assistance is given No placement cell here but provides good internship seminars. You can apply for a job if you want to have after Completing your B.Sc. I would personally suggest to opt for higher studies rather than getting into a job coz then you'll get more fields to work in, with a good paid salary.

Campus Life

3.5

Many fests and freshers are organised on 3 to 4 months gap for the students. Various tech fests are also organised The College has a well-stocked library with a rich collection of around 50000 books, journals, and magazines.The total seating capacity of the library is 100 students and provides individual reading carrels, lounge area for browsing. Classrooms are not big but have all the necessary facilities like well maintained boards, proper tables and chairs. Classrooms are very neat and clean Our college has one cricket and one football ground. It also contain a lawn. Sports equipment are well maintained but new equipments takes time to come. Many events are also organised in which one can participate There are a lot of cultural groups and societies created by students and teachers both in which one can participate

Interview Experience

3

No for admission in colleges of du no group discussion, interview or written test is taken one should score good in 12 the exams and just wait for the merit list to be released on website of du. Merit list is just released after 12-15 days after the announcement of class 12th results. If your percentage falls under the range of the percentage mentioned in the course you want to opt in you will get admission but if not, you can wait as about 5 to 6 merit list is released by du. The difference is that if your class 12th percentage is good you can get very best colleges in first cutoff.
